Resumo: Composites are materials increasingly used due to their characteristics and properties and the process Hand Lay Up is one of the most common process used in the word because it is a process that doesn’t need a high investment in machines as in other processes but it is mandatory to expend resources in research and development (R&D). When a part of composites is manufactured, typical deviations normally appear depending on the manufacturing process, geometry of the part, human factors, materials, etc... The process Hand Lay Up is a very slow process because the manual sheet placement stage consume about half of the total process time, and for this reason, the corrective actions to solve the deviations which appear during the cure cycle, should be taken in this stage, during the Hand Lay Up. As the name of the thesis shows: “SPECIAL MATERIALS FOR SOLVE DEVIATIONS APPEARED IN MANUFACTURING PARTS OF CFRP AND GFRP” the approach is showing how with some special materials it is possible to solve typical deviations that appear during the manufacturing process of a part of composites, and demonstrating how it is possible to decrease total cost by adding or modifying the typical material used in the process Hand Lau UP. The special materials used for eradicating the defects are ancillary materials. Ancillary materials are used only during the manufacturing process, but they do not remain incorporated to the part and are divided by two types: Material Type A and Material Type B. During the thesis, on one hand, we will analyze how is possible to solve defects of Lack of resin, surface porosity, delamination and excess of resin appeared during the manufacturing of Hollow Parts of GFRP using ancillary materials Type A, and on the other hand, defects of Porosity between layers, lack of resin and surface porosity appeared during the manufacturing of Planar Parts with special radius of CFRP using ancillary materials Type B. Finally, with a business case will be demonstrate how is possible to decrease total costs using these ancillary materials. In one case replacing conventional materials used during the performing of the vacuum bag and in other case adding a new material.
